Mirum Pharmaceuticals, a biopharmaceutical company focused on rare disease treatment, seeks a Regional Business Director to lead commercial operations across the Southeast (NC, TN, GA, FL). This is a first-line field leadership role managing a team of 7 Regional Account Managers responsible for delivering strong business performance and meaningful patient impact in rare cholestatic liver disease. Key responsibilities include translating national and zone strategy into focused regional execution, building a culture of continuous learning and accountability, and ensuring clinical credibility and business discipline. The RBD will lead team recruitment, onboarding, development, and retention while spending meaningful time in the field coaching, observing customer engagement, and providing actionable feedback. You'll develop individualized development plans, create stretch opportunities, and build succession readiness. The role requires developing thoughtful account strategies reflecting local patient journeys, referral networks, and access dynamics. You'll raise the quality and consistency of customer engagement across pediatric and adult hepatology and gastroenterology settings, support compliant coordination to remove barriers in the patient journey, and promote customer experiences grounded in trust and empathy. You'll maintain strong knowledge of rare cholestatic liver disease, the Liver portfolio, market dynamics, patient support pathways, and competitive landscape. Cross-functional partnership is essential—you'll collaborate with Marketing, Medical Affairs, Market Access, Patient Services, Commercial Training, Operations, and Advocacy to bring forward field insights and align partners around regional opportunities. The ideal candidate demonstrates strong people leadership, clinical acumen, business judgment, and the ability to set high standards while creating a safe, inclusive environment. You'll own regional results, budget management, forecasting, and resource stewardship while maintaining compliance and championing change.
